Picking a Trusted Electrical Expert: A Guide for Homeowners

When it concerns keeping the security and capability of your home, finding a relied on electrical contractor is crucial. Electrical job is not only complex yet likewise potentially dangerous otherwise managed correctly. Whether you need routine upkeep, emergency situation repairs, or a complete electrical installation, having a reliable electrical contractor can make all the difference. This guide will aid you recognize what to seek in a trusted electrical contractor and how to make sure that your electrical needs are consulted with professionalism and care.

Firstly, qualifications matter. A trusted electrical expert needs to be completely accredited and guaranteed. This not only safeguards you as the home owner in situation of accidents but likewise ensures that the electrical expert has satisfied the necessary training and instructional demands to do electric job securely and properly. Always ask to see their certificate and paperwork to validate their legitimacy, and do not think twice to inspect their standing with regional licensing boards or customer security agencies.

One more critical factor in selecting an electrical expert is their experience and reputation. Seek electrical experts that have a strong background of working in your city, as they will be familiar with the specific electrical codes and laws that concern your area. Reading on the internet reviews, requesting references, or examining systems like Angie’s Listing or Yelp can provide you with understanding into the experiences of previous customers. A trusted electrical contractor will have a profile of satisfied customers and favorable responses, showcasing their dependability and quality of job.

Communication and professionalism and trust are additionally essential attributes to think about. A relied on electrical expert ought to want to talk about the extent of job, supply estimates, and describe the procedures associated with nonprofessional’s terms. They should additionally be receptive to your questions or concerns, showing transparency throughout the entire work. A great electrical contractor will put in the time to guarantee you are notified about the work being done, offering you satisfaction and confidence in their abilities.

Lastly, keep in mind that price is very important, yet it should not be the single determining variable. While it might be tempting to opt for the most affordable cost choice, this can often bring about subpar job or hidden prices down the line. Choose electricians that supply affordable, in-depth price quotes that break down the solutions provided. By valuing quality over the lowest cost, you can guarantee that the electric job done in your home is both risk-free and sustainable for years to come.

To conclude, locating a relied on electrical contractor needs mindful research study and consideration. By concentrating on credentials, experience, interaction, and reasonable rates, you can make an enlightened option that safeguards your home’s electrical systems. Whether you’re facing an immediate repair work or intending an upgrade, relying on the best specialist can supply you with the self-confidence that your electric requirements remain in qualified hands.

Understanding the Role and Importance of Electricians

Electricians play a vital role in modern society, responsible for the installation, maintenance, and repair of electrical systems. Whether in residential, commercial, or industrial settings, their expertise ensures that we have safe and reliable access to electricity. As technology evolves, the demand for skilled electricians continues to grow, making this profession both a stable and rewarding career choice.

The path to becoming an electrician typically begins with education and training. Many electricians start their careers through apprenticeships, during which they receive hands-on experience under the supervision of seasoned professionals. This combination of classroom instruction and practical training equips them with the necessary skills and knowledge to handle various electrical tasks, from wiring homes to troubleshooting complex systems.

Safety is a paramount concern for electricians. They must adhere to strict safety standards and regulations to protect themselves and their clients. Understanding the National Electrical Code (NEC) and local building codes is essential, as these guidelines ensure that electrical installations are performed safely and effectively. Electricians are also trained to use a variety of tools and equipment, making their work not only efficient but also compliant with safety practices.

The role of electricians extends beyond basic electrical work. Many electricians specialize in specific areas such as renewable energy systems, commercial electrical systems, or home automation technologies. As the world increasingly shifts towards sustainable energy sources, electricians with skills in solar panel installation and energy-efficient systems are becoming highly sought after. Their ability to adapt and specialize in emerging technologies allows them to stay competitive in a rapidly changing job market.

In conclusion, electricians are indispensable professionals whose work ensures that our homes and businesses operate smoothly and safely. With the growing reliance on advanced electrical systems and renewable technologies, the demand for qualified electricians is set to increase. For those considering a career in this field, the journey may be challenging, but the rewards in terms of job stability, varied opportunities, and the satisfaction of contributing to society cannot be overstated.

The Importance of Surfboard Leashes: A Guide to Staying Safe in the Water

As a surfer, you know that the thrill of riding the waves is unmatched. However, with great power comes great responsibility, and one of the most crucial aspects of surfing is ensuring your safety while in the water. One of the most effective ways to do this is by using a surfboard leash. In this article, we’ll delve into the importance of surfboard leashes, how they work, and what to look for when choosing the right one for your surfing needs.

What is a Surfboard Leash?
————————-

A surfboard leash is a cord or strap that attaches your surfboard to your ankle, preventing it from separating from you while you’re in the water. This simple yet effective device has been a staple in the surfing community for decades, and for good reason. Without a leash, your board can become a hazard to yourself and others, causing injuries and damage to property.

How Does a Surfboard Leash Work?
——————————–

A surfboard leash works by attaching to your ankle and the tail of your surfboard. When you’re riding a wave, the leash keeps your board close to you, preventing it from slipping away or getting lost in the water. This not only keeps you safe but also allows you to focus on your surfing technique and enjoy the ride without worrying about your board.

Types of Surfboard Leashes
—————————

There are several types of surfboard leashes available, each with its own unique features and benefits. Some of the most common types include:

1. Standard Leashes: These are the most common type of leash and are suitable for most surfers. They typically consist of a cord or strap that attaches to your ankle and the tail of your board.
2. Coiled Leashes: These leashes have a coiled design that allows for more flexibility and movement while surfing. They’re ideal for surfers who like to perform tricks and maneuvers.
3. Stretch Leashes: These leashes have a stretchy material that allows for more give and take while surfing. They’re perfect for surfers who like to ride bigger waves or perform high-speed maneuvers.
4. Quick-Release Leashes: These leashes have a quick-release mechanism that allows you to quickly detach from your board in case of an emergency.

What to Look for When Choosing a Surfboard Leash
————————————————

When choosing a surfboard leash, there are several factors to consider. Here are a few things to keep in mind:

1. Material: Look for leashes made from durable, high-quality materials that can withstand the rigors of surfing.
2. Length: Choose a leash that’s the right length for your surfing style and board size. A leash that’s too long can get in the way, while one that’s too short may not provide enough protection.
3. Adjustability: Opt for a leash that’s adjustable, allowing you to customize the fit to your ankle and board.
4. Durability: A leash that’s prone to breaking or tangling is not worth the investment. Look for leashes with reinforced stitching and durable materials.
5. Price: Surfboard leashes can range in price from a few dollars to over $50. Set a budget and look for leashes that meet your needs within that range.

Benefits of Using a Surfboard Leash
———————————–

Using a surfboard leash has numerous benefits, including:

1. Increased Safety: A leash prevents your board from separating from you, reducing the risk of injury or damage to property.
2. Improved Surfing Experience: With a leash, you can focus on your surfing technique and enjoy the ride without worrying about your board.
3. Reduced Stress: A leash takes the pressure off, allowing you to relax and enjoy the surfing experience.
4. Better Board Control: A leash gives you more control over your board, allowing you to make adjustments and corrections on the fly.

Conclusion
———-

In conclusion, surfboard leashes are an essential piece of surfing equipment that can greatly enhance your surfing experience. By understanding how they work, the different types available, and what to look for when choosing a leash, you can ensure your safety and enjoyment while in the water. Whether you’re a beginner or an experienced surfer, a surfboard leash is an investment worth making. So, next time you hit the waves, make sure you’re properly equipped with a high-quality surfboard leash.

Erosion Control Measures in New Hampshire: Protecting the Granite State’s Natural Beauty

New Hampshire, known for its picturesque landscapes and rugged terrain, is a state that is deeply connected to its natural environment. From the White Mountains to the coastal regions, the state’s diverse geography is a major draw for tourists and residents alike. However, this natural beauty is not without its challenges. Erosion, a natural process that shapes the earth’s surface, can have devastating effects on the state’s ecosystems and infrastructure. In this article, we will explore the erosion control measures in New Hampshire and the importance of protecting the state’s natural resources.

Erosion is a natural process that occurs when the land’s surface is worn away by wind, water, or ice. In New Hampshire, erosion is a significant concern due to the state’s rugged terrain and heavy rainfall. The state’s many rivers, streams, and lakes are prone to flooding, which can lead to soil erosion and sedimentation. Additionally, the state’s many roads and highways are susceptible to erosion, which can lead to costly repairs and maintenance.

To combat erosion, the state of New Hampshire has implemented a range of erosion control measures. One of the most effective measures is the use of riprap, a type of rock or concrete that is placed along the banks of rivers and streams to prevent erosion. Riprap is particularly effective in areas where the soil is loose or unstable, and it can help to prevent the loss of soil and sediment into waterways.

Another important erosion control measure is the use of vegetation. Vegetation, such as grasses and shrubs, can help to stabilize soil and prevent erosion. This is because the roots of the plants help to hold the soil in place, and the leaves and stems provide a natural barrier against wind and water. In New Hampshire, the state’s many parks and forests are home to a wide range of vegetation, which helps to prevent erosion and maintain the state’s natural beauty.

In addition to riprap and vegetation, the state of New Hampshire also uses a range of other erosion control measures. These include the use of geotextiles, which are permeable fabrics that allow water to pass through while preventing soil erosion. Geotextiles are often used in areas where the soil is loose or unstable, and they can help to prevent the loss of soil and sediment into waterways.

The state of New Hampshire also uses a range of structural erosion control measures. These include the use of retaining walls, which are designed to prevent erosion by holding back soil and sediment. Retaining walls are often used in areas where the soil is unstable or prone to erosion, and they can help to prevent the loss of soil and sediment into waterways.

In addition to these measures, the state of New Hampshire also takes a proactive approach to erosion control. This includes the use of erosion control plans, which are designed to identify areas prone to erosion and develop strategies to prevent it. Erosion control plans are often developed in conjunction with local communities and stakeholders, and they can help to ensure that erosion control measures are effective and sustainable.

The importance of erosion control in New Hampshire cannot be overstated. Erosion can have devastating effects on the state’s ecosystems and infrastructure, including the loss of soil and sediment, damage to roads and bridges, and increased risk of flooding. By implementing effective erosion control measures, the state can help to protect its natural resources and maintain its natural beauty.

In conclusion, erosion control measures in New Hampshire are crucial for protecting the state’s natural resources and maintaining its natural beauty. From the use of riprap and vegetation to geotextiles and structural erosion control measures, the state has implemented a range of effective measures to prevent erosion. By taking a proactive approach to erosion control, the state can help to ensure that its natural resources are protected for future generations.
